General Viability Questions (PvP)

Hope everyone got some decent shiny clamperls today! After looking at moves and stats for different pokemon, I as curious about the community's opinions on the following pokemon:

Gorebyss: 100% comes out to 2494, access to both Confusion (hard hitting with plenty of energy gain) and Draining Kiss (easiest fairy move to get off, but not by much); while its stats make it more of a glass cannon, could this deal enough damage to a Giratina to be relevant at all in the Ultra League?

In the Great League, with these same moves, does its viability change?

Huntail: Can't get to Ultra level, so mostly focusing on Great League applications; Access to some of the fastest moves as well as water gun, without Qwillfish's second typing (a blessing or a curse depending on the scenario), which performed well in the Twilight cup as a lead. Does Huntail stand up to its spiky cousin or no?

Kingler: Bit of a weird one to ask about, but the event gifted me a 1490 so I thought I might as well try for it. X-Scissor provides a bit of coverage against grass types, and Vice Grip, one of the most infamously bad moves in all of GO, seems like it even has the potential to be viable as a spammy move for 1x damage on most everything. Once again, we come to stats that leave a glass cannon; is it viable in Great League at all?

Luimneon: While this fish is mostly just pretty, with the recent chance of a stat boost being added to certain moves, and Lumineon having access to Silver Wind, along with either Water Gun or Waterfall, seems relevant to me.

If you've used these in PvP or have an opinion/point I forgot, please tell me about your experience! Looking to see if any of these guys is worth turning into a battlemon!

In short, gorebyss could be fun for ultra, but Blastoise has ultra and azumaril has great league locked down pretty tight on water side.

First off, bubble and then water gun is the best fast move for water types if they have it.

Gorebyss, as you said is a bit glass cannon-ish, but it cant deal with Giratina's pure bulk. Suicune with ice beam is better suited, but Gorebyss wants water gun, less energy wasted in overcharge, but DK likely wont hurt giratina too much.

Lumineon, could be fun if the stats go up, but other wise, another pretty fish, water gun's better

Kingler, X scissor could be good agaisnt meganium, it also has the very strong move bubble. Though it doesnt have anything for Altaria/Flygon matches, which is why azumaril tends to take great league as the water type.

Huntale, not sure, as It suffers similar problems to kingler, competition from azumaril, outside of twilight cup, I haven't heard much about quilfish (at this time, I'm assuming due to the limitations in types of the cup's meta not being conducive for azumaril's typical rampaging)

All of them have some meta relevance, but seemingly not more than other pokemon, they have one good move, but their second moves are where they loose out. They seem like they can be serviceable teammembers and can work, but may take more than current waterchamps Azumarill and blastoise
